Document 277-1  
Power Inductors  
RFB Series  
• Low cost, high current power inductors  
• 2.2 µH to 18 mH inductance range  
• RFB0810 and RFB1010 have a flame retardant polyolefin  
wrap to protect the winding.  
Core material Ferrite  
Terminations Tin-silver over tin over copper over steel. Other termi-  
nations available at additional cost.  
Ambient temperature –40°C to +85°C with Irms current, +85°C to  
+125°C with derated current  
Storage temperature Component: –40°C to +85°C.  
Tray packaging: –40°C to +80°C  
Moisture Sensitivity Level (MSL) 1 (unlimited floor life at <30°C /  
85% relative humidity)  
Failures in Time (FIT) / Mean Time Between Failures (MTBF)  
38 per billion hours / 26,315,789 hours, calculated per Telcordia SR-332  
Packaging 150 parts per tray; optional fanfold tape for RFB0807 and  
RFB0810  
PCB washing Tested with pure water or alcohol only. For other solvents,  
see Doc787_PCB_Washing.pdf

1. When ordering, please specify termination code:  
RFB0807-183L  
Termination: L = Tin-silver over tin over copper over steel.  
Special order: T = RoHS tin-silver-copper (95.5/4/0.5)  
or S = non-RoHS tin-lead (63/37).  
To order parts packaged in fanfold tape (800 parts per box), add the letter “F” at the end of the  
part number.  
2. Inductance tested at 100 kHz, 0.1 Vrms, 0 Adc on an Agilent/HP 4284A LCR-meter or equivalent.  
3. SRF measured using Agilent/HP 4191A or equivalent.  
4. DC current at which the inductance drops 10% (typ) from its value without current.  
5. Current that causes the specified temperature rise from 25°C ambient.  
6. Electrical specifications at 25°C.
